Data Owner Lead - BANGALORE

We have an exciting opportunity for Data Owner role, responsible for establishing ownership and controls for critical product data to enable analytics, compliance, and client impact.

As a Data Owner Lead within Consumer & Community Banking Data & Analytics team, you play a vital role in enabling faster innovation by ensuring data is clearly documented, high-quality, and well-protected. You are responsible for overseeing all data created, provisioned, or consumed in business applications, supporting objectives from operations to advanced analytics and AI/ML use cases. You serve as a subject matter expert, helping to define and classify data critical to your business area. You collaborate closely with technology and business partners to deliver data that meets quality and safety requirements. Together, we execute processes that identify, monitor, and mitigate data risks throughout the data life cycle, ensuring compliance with firm policies and standards.

 

Job responsibilities

  • As Product Owner for data delivery teams, build and groom the backlog defining initiatives and epics to guide the team's work and outcomes
  • Develop data strategy to define & deliver on AI ready data products
  • Create plans on how to develop and deliver data for the business area to support business operations, strategic objectives, advanced analytics and AI/ML use cases
  • Document requirements for the content and quality of data for their business area, and coordinate with technology and business partners to deliver requirements
  • Develop processes and procedures in the product (data as a product) management lifecycle. Identify, monitor, and mitigate data risks across the data lifecycle in their business area, include risks related to data protection, retention and destruction, storage, use, and quality
  • Partner with technology and business resources to resolve identified data issues in a timely and consistent manner
  • Manage direct or matrixed staff to execute data-related tasks
